What shapes the price

The cost follows the real operating burden.

MySidekick is deliberately avoiding a simple “number of agents” price because that would hide the factors that actually determine whether the service can be reliable and sustainable.

Implementation effortBlueprint, configuration, integration work, validation, approval design and controlled release.
Systems and workflow complexityHow much customer-specific setup is required versus how much can come from reusable MySidekick components.
Execution and provider costn8n, models/APIs, hosting, third-party services, payment costs and other usage-driven inputs.
Care and support burdenIssue handling, integration repair, configuration changes, maintenance and ongoing improvement.
Commercial sustainabilityThe service must support a healthy margin while maintaining the quality, accountability and support customers are actually buying.
